I have been keeping a casual eye out for a downpipe for my A3 for a long time. For those of you that don't know, us A3 quattro drivers have the lovely benefit of having the same turbo as an a3 and the same drive as an s3, meaning that both their downpipes are useless. The tqs are not the most common of cars, and as such the downpipes always came with a bit of a premium, until now.

The Long Review:

Initial thoughts;

When it arrived I was impressed by the quality of the downpipe. Welds looked good and all felt very solid. These thoughts were backed up by the mechanic who fitted it.
(Got to give him a shout out as he said he was having fun with this job nearly all day yesterday. Ben @ Parsons Performance, aka BENJAMIN on here. Any one in East Sussex could do a lot worse then taking your car their)

Initial thoughts when on the car:

I was told by the boys that it was quite quiet. I was amazed that when I turned it on it didn't sound like they'd installed it! On idle the car sounds nearly identical, which is perfect for me as I don't want my car to sound like its got some big *** barry cans on it, but as I gave it a few revs you could hear it was a lot crisper then the old system. I was reliably informed that it sounded much better under load and the stainless obviously needed time to get coked up, so I took their word for it.

Left it running for a bit before starting the journey home and under load their is a noticeable difference! Car sounds so much crisper, seems to have smoothed it out and be more willing through the rev range as well, and once hot downshifts make for a lovely overrun noise. It really kicks in about 3k, which makes sense, and over the 40odd miles I have done on it my MPG is down to 20.5 so I have been using the right foot a fair bit. :racer: The whole car seems more alive, but still pretty subtle if you need to go sensibly through a town centre etc, and goes very well with my resonated exhaust. I think a non res would give it a more raspy noise, but I want to keep some of the comforts that made me choose an Audi in the first place.

The Short Review:

Very well made, a good fit, lovely noise under load especially when boost hits, car pulls better through revs, highly recommended.

Put a fair few miles on the car over the weekend and the downpipe noise is a lot better for it.

Subtle under 2750rpm, lovely sounding over it.. Sounds great when warm, and no funky smells now the stainless has coked up.

Touch wood, the downpipe is not blowing at all, so should be fine now. A great product by relentless.

All in all, a massive winner.
